YS Jagan Offers Chadar At Kadapa’s Ameen Peer Dargah
29 May 2019 5:10 PM

Andhra Pradesh chief minister designate YS Jagan Mohan Reddy offered special prayers and a chadar at the celebrated Ameen Peer dargah also known as Pedda Dargah in Kadapa. Accompanied by Rajya Sabha MP Vijay Sai Reddy, Kadapa Lok Sabha member YS Avinash Reddy and local MLA Amjad Basha among others, the YSRCP supremo offered a chadar bedecked with flowers as he took part in the traditional prayer ceremony.
He was welcomed by the custodian and committee members of the dargah who presented him with a traditional shawl and tied a turban to the YSRCP chief's head.
The chief minister designate landed at Kapada from Tirumala after offering prayers there and will now proceed to Pulivendula. He is scheduled to take part in the thanksgiving prayers being organised at the CSI Church there.
